TRUE or FALSE statement "People who travel for business purposes tend to pay lower fare for airline flights because their demand is more elastic than other passengers"

Answers

Answer 1

The statement is FALSE. People who travel for business purposes do not necessarily pay lower fares for airline flights because their demand is more elastic than other passengers.

The elasticity of demand measures the responsiveness of quantity demanded to changes in price. In the case of business travelers, their demand tends to be less elastic, meaning that they are less sensitive to changes in price compared to other passengers.

Business travelers often have specific travel needs and schedules that are less flexible, making them less responsive to changes in ticket prices. They may have time-sensitive meetings or obligations that require them to travel on specific dates and times, regardless of the fare.

On the other hand, leisure travelers or tourists typically have more flexibility in their travel plans and can adjust their schedules based on price fluctuations. Their demand tends to be more elastic, as they can choose to travel during off-peak times or select alternative destinations if fares are too high.

Therefore, it is incorrect to say that business travelers pay lower fares because their demand is more elastic. In fact, they may often pay higher fares due to their less elastic demand.

In computing the GDP, why is it import spending subtracted from the sum of consumption, investment, government purchases and export spending?
-Economics

Answers

Import spending is subtracted from the sum of consumption, investment, government purchases and export spending in the calculation of GDP because import represents spending on goods and services that are not produced in that economy.

Gross domestic product is the total sum of goods and services produced in a particular economy in a given period. One of the ways that can be used to determine the value of GDP is the expenditure approach.

The expenditure approach to determine GDP = Consumption + investment + government purchases + ( export - import).

if a company needs capital and wants to issue new stock but the current stock price is undervalued, the company can use convertibles to sell stock at a predetermined price.

Answers

Convertible securities are a popular tool for companies to raise capital without diluting the value of their existing shares.

Convertible securities allow investors to buy shares at a fixed price, but they also have the option to convert those shares into a predetermined number of the company's common shares. This flexibility allows investors to benefit from the upside potential of the company's stock while also providing downside protection.

If a company needs to raise capital but believes that its current stock price is undervalued, issuing convertibles can be an attractive option. By setting a fixed price for the convertible securities, the company can raise capital without selling its existing shares at a lower price. Additionally, if the stock price rises above the predetermined price, investors can convert their securities into common shares and benefit from the higher value.

Overall, convertible securities provide companies with a flexible way to raise capital while also providing investors with attractive risk-reward characteristics. However, companies must carefully consider the terms of the securities and the impact on existing shareholders before issuing convertibles.

An organization uses a database and application development tools through a cloud provider's _____ services.

Answers

An organization uses a database and application development tools through a cloud provider's PaaS services.

What is the significance of PaaS service?

PaaS stands for Platform as a service. Platform as a service a complete development and deployment environment in the cloud.

Platform as a service consist of resources that enable the organizations to deliver everything from simple cloud-based apps to the sophisticated, cloud-enabled enterprise applications.

Basicaly, PaaS is use to create business applications much more quickly than with on-site solutions.
